Rev. Michael Awe and Rev. Henry Witte visit Mission Central

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

What a blessing to see the leadership of Hope Lutheran Church at South Sioux City, Nebraska take the lead in reaching out the Hispanic people that God is sending to South Sioux City, and also to Sioux City.

Yes, under the leadership of Rev. Dr. Michael Awe, Senior Pastor of Hope Lutheran Church in South Sioux City, Nebraska a special new outreach to the Hispanic population has been established.  Assisting in this effort is Veteran Missionary Rev. Henry Witte, who served so faithfully many years in Venezuela and Panama.  Rev. Witte understands the culture and speaks the heart language of the Hispanic people.

This new effort has been established as a result of the combined efforts of the Nebraska District and the Iowa District West.  This new project is one that Mission Central is involved in and has a special Adoption Agreement for the assistance and support of this new effort.  Rev. Awe and Rev. Witte both came to Mission Central and had their picture taken with our Boss here at this Miracle Place.  This special agreement and mission opportunity is available to all the congregations, in the entire Siouxland Area, and also to families and mission minded people in the entire Mid-West!!!  We need prayers for this effort and support to keep this outreach going….
